King, Wylie Crush FBN Winter Open Bass Tournament

The Florida Bass Nation has been preparing for the 2015 season. To kick off the new year, the FBN held the Winter Open Bass Tournament on the St. Johns River, site of the 2014 FBN State Championship. 15 teams launched from Crystal Cove Resort on January 24th in search of a few of the lunkers the river system is known to produce.

Scott King and Christian Wylie found some of those river monsters, crushing the field of anglers with an even 26.00-pound, 5 bass limit. King and Wylie anchored their giant bag with a 7.44-pounder that won Big Bass honors.

The rest of the field struggled in comparison. Jerry and Jason Gutierrez were the next closest competitors, as they weighed an 11.35-pound limit for a second place finish. John King and Artis Allen finished in third place, weighing a 7.74-pound limit.

The Florida Bass Nation’s first Pro/Am Qualifier will take place tomorrow on the St. Johns River, again launching from Crystal Cove Resort.
